Personally I don’t think you will get the best experience running iptv on a smart tv.
The epg is not going to run that smoothly especially when scrolling quickly through it, because of the TVS cpu and ram capabilities.
High end TVS will probably be slightly better.
Also keeping apps installed to a minimum will help.
